Description
The first "migrant corridor" in the Orbits dataset includes a total of 5,203 observations and 207 variables. This dataset examines the migration trajectory of Romanians in Spain, as well as their social ties within both countries, along with other transnational ties. Specifically, it focuses on the largest migration corridor between Dâmbovița (Romania) on one side and Castelló (Spain) on the other.
The dataset consists of egos (303), alters (4,803), and references provided by the ego to conduct additional interviews (97). These observations fall into three categories corresponding to different migrant groups. The first group, "MS," includes those observations related to migrants who moved to Castelló and settled there (2,186). The second group, "NM" (2,667), contains observations concerning respondents who never moved to Spain. Lastly, the "RM" category (350) consists of migrants who, after spending some time in the Spanish province, decided to return to their place of origin in Romania.
